Product Description: The single most important topic in finance today is the art and science of credit risk management. Growing dissatisfaction with traditional credit risk measurement methods has combined with regulations imposed by the Bank for International Settlements (BIS) in 1993 to send numerous financial institutions in search of alternative "internal model" approaches to measuring the credit risk of a loan or portfolio of loans...read more (view table of contents, read Amazon.com's description)

Product Description: With so many customs and traditions during the Christmas season, we often do not pause to wonder and ponder about how and why they began. Of all the seasonal celebrations of the year, Christmas has more traditional plants with their accompanying legends and symbolism than any other season...read more (view table of contents, read Amazon.com's description)

Product Description: Although girls enter school more "math ready" than boys, statistics show that by the time they graduate from high school they will have been outdistanced by males both in critical test scores and in level of interest. What has happened in the intervening years and what can we do to stop it? In Feisty Females, the authors offer some insight and propose a solution...read more (view table of contents, read Amazon.com's description)
